Effective Weed Control Services: Simple Guidance for Caring for Outdoor Spaces


More than a visual issue, weeds can cause structural problems. They draw nutrients away from other plants, weaken hard surfaces, and lead to persistent issues if not dealt with. In commercial environments and urban locations, weed infestations often escalate without warning.



Using a professional weed management team ensures a planned approach to dealing with weed growth. Rather than delaying until the damage is done, a preventative schedule prevents worsening problems and reduces future expenses.



Why Use Professional Weed Control?



Qualified operators know how different species behave. Some weeds propagate visibly, while others return through underground roots. Using this knowledge allows for targeted control and reduces the chance of harming desired plants.



Importantly, all treatments are done in compliance with legislation. That means appropriate product usage, precise application methods, and site-specific planning—including nearby water. The reassurance of proper weed management is essential for councils and contractors.



Long-Term Benefits of Continued Care





Weeds growing through concrete or tarmac weaken the structure. Regular treatment protects these assets and avoids seasonal damage.



Seasonal Weed Management



As temperatures rise, weeds take hold fast. Acting early avoids larger problems later. Weed control is also needed during autumn and winter, especially for persistent species that remain active underground.



With a seasonal plan, grounds remain manageable whatever the time of year.
